Chook annex rebuild – Part 10
Wire barrier skirt - Finishing
Weather didn't look to good this morning and surprised it cleared as well as it did so back out to finish stapling the wire skirt to the base timbers so we can screw on the plinth boards. The final bit for this phase of the job is to back-fill and level the soil - all of a sudden the site looks neat and tidy.

Chook annex - Part 9B
Finishing the gate
Gate accessories fitted and final strip of cage wire on the left stapled down.
I'm using 150mm fence palings as plinth boards around the base and when I paint those I'll also do the left jamb. Before I fit the boards I'll dig out around the base some more and bury all the left over wire as a fox barrier.
